Engagement model

Start with the environment—not a generic demo.

Each engagement begins with explicit operating boundaries and ends with measurable evidence. The objective is to determine where AI adds defensible security value and where stronger foundations are still required.

01

Define the operating boundary

Identify the environment, threat model, data sources, permitted actions, governance requirements, and success criteria.

02

Establish evidence coverage

Connect selected sources, measure health and delivery, and validate what the system can and cannot observe.

03

Run supervised operations

Evaluate findings, investigations, challenge outcomes, analyst overrides, and proposed responses under active review.

04

Measure the outcome

Report on coverage, investigation quality, false positives, response safety, operational effort, and unresolved gaps.
